Best time to go

The best time to visit Cádiz is during the spring or autumn months (April-May or September-October). During these months, the weather is mild and pleasant, making it ideal for exploring the city. However, Cádiz can be visited year-round, as the winters are relatively mild and the summers are hot and sunny.

What to Eat

Cádiz is known for its delicious seafood. Some of the local specialties include:

  • Pescaíto frito: Fried fish is a popular dish in Cádiz. It is typically made with small fish, such as sardines, anchovies, and squid.
  • Tortillitas de camarones: These are shrimp fritters made with flour, water, and shrimp.
  • Chicharrones: These are fried pork belly cubes.
  • Berza: This is a stew made with cabbage, chickpeas, and pork.

Where to Go

Cádiz is a beautiful city with a rich history and culture. Some of the most popular tourist attractions include:

  • Cathedral of Cádiz: This is one of the most important religious buildings in Andalusia. It is known for its impressive Baroque architecture.
  • Torre Tavira: This is a watchtower that offers stunning views of the city and the surrounding area.
  • Plaza de España: This is a large square that is surrounded by beautiful buildings. It is a popular spot for tourists and locals alike.
  • Playa de la Caleta: This is a small beach that is located in the heart of the city. It is a popular spot for swimming, sunbathing, and enjoying the views.
